How is technique defined in this material?

Explanation:
Technique is the method you use to successfully complete a movement. It’s the deliberate sequence of actions and positions—the setup, alignment, bar path, timing, breathing, and control—that lets you move efficiently and safely. This definition emphasizes learning a repeatable approach to perform each movement correctly, which also helps you progress by handling heavier loads or more reps. It’s not about a training heart rate zone, a measure of endurance, or a gear list.
